July 5, 2026 12:56 PM CT | 90 mph | 1 NW Boardman | OH | NWS damage survey confirms a macroburst that produced wind speeds up to 90 mph across portions of Mahoning County. |
July 5, 2026 1:15 PM CT | 60 mph | 2 SW Austintown | OH | 60+mph wind estimates and nickel side hail near State Route 46 and Kirk Rd. |
July 5, 2026 1:22 PM CT | 65 mph | Poland | OH | Estimated 60-65 mph winds and dime size hail. |
July 5, 2026 1:25 PM CT | 60 mph | 2 E Austintown | OH | Spotter estimated 50-60 mph winds and measured over 1 inch of rain in 30 minutes. |
July 5, 2026 1:25 PM CT | 77 mph | 1 NW Poland | OH | Measured on handheld anemometer. |
| Date & Time | Rating | City | State | Description |
|---|---|---|---|---|
July 5, 2026 1:03 PM CT | UNK | 3 NE Canfield | OH | An NWS survey team confirms a brief EF-1 tornado occurred in Canfield Township with max wind speeds of 95 mph. |
